Teamfight Tactics: Mastering the Two Brand New Galaxies Added in Patch 10.8

This morning, patch 10.8 officially landed on the Vietnam server, and Teamfight Tactics has undergone significant changes.

Trade Galaxy – Players get a free reroll once each round

Essentially, in this galaxy, players will spend less gold to roll for their desired team composition, thereby allowing 2-star units to appear relatively early. In general, with the same amount of gold compared to normal, you will have more options in building your team, and it frequently happens that you can pivot your strategy after rolling too many champions of the same type.

The basic playstyle will have two main approaches: rolling hard to achieve 3-star units early or leveling up quickly to acquire expensive 2-star units. In the first approach, compositions like Guardian – Celestial or Blademaster with Master Yi and Yasuo will be popular choices to reroll heavily for early 3-star units. With champions in patch 10.8 increasing damage to the Spirit Beast when surviving, this playstyle is viable and not too weak in the later stages.

The second approach is to level up quickly to acquire expensive 2-star units, typically 4-cost units that can carry the game like Kayle, Irelia, Jhin… Essentially, you will play similarly to before but focus on leveling up more in the late game after reaching 50 gold, rather than spending 1 or 2 rounds just rolling for champions to upgrade your team.

Island Galaxy – Upon reaching level 5, players receive a Natural Armor

In Island Galaxy, you’ll see strong, complete compositions emerge early, usually around level 7, which can snowball effectively. Currently, there are also two main playstyles in Island Galaxy, relying heavily on the nature of the compositions rather than the financial aspect.

The first playstyle is to reroll aggressively at level 7, relying on compositions with strong carries in the 3-cost champion tier. Key representatives include Sorcerer – Star Guardian (slow roll for a 3-star Syndra but still needs to level up to 8), Blademaster – Void (with Master Yi and Yasuo as key champions), and Pilot – Assassin (not highly recommended due to nerfs on Shaco and Super Robot). The characteristic of these compositions is that 4-cost units contribute effects rather than being the main carries.

The other playstyle remains to play as usual and choose strong compositions at level 8. With the addition of one more unit from the Natural Armor, you can add some effects to boost damage. Typical examples include Brawler – Gunner combined with Rebel or Cybernetic; the Cybernetic composition can also gain additional buffs like Divine, Time Warp, and Demonic to help the backline deal better damage.
